Ingredients You’ll Need

Let’s gather some simple, wholesome ingredients to create this delightful salad. You’ll find that everything you need is easy to find at your local grocery store.

For the Salad

  • 1 cup quinoa, rinsed and drained
  • 2 cups water
  • 1 cup red bell pepper, diced
  • 1 cup cucumber, diced
  • 1 cup shredded carrots
  • 1 cup green onions, sliced
  • 1/2 cup chopped fresh cilantro
  • 1/2 cup chopped peanuts
  • 1/4 cup sesame seeds

For the Dressing

  • 1/4 cup soy sauce
  • 2 tablespoons lime juice
  • 1 tablespoon honey
  • 1 tablespoon sesame oil
  • 1 teaspoon grated fresh ginger
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• Salt and pepper to taste

How to Make Thai Quinoa Crunch Salad: A Refreshing Healthy Delight!

Step 1: Cook the Quinoa

In a medium saucepan, combine the rinsed quinoa and water. Bring it to a boil over medium-high heat. Reducing the heat to low after boiling allows the quinoa to simmer gently for about 15 minutes until it’s fluffy and the water has been absorbed. This step is crucial because perfectly cooked quinoa serves as the foundation of our salad.

Step 2: Prep Your Veggies

While the quinoa cools, chop up all those vibrant veggies! Dice your red bell pepper, cucumber, shred those carrots, and slice green onions. Freshly chopped cilantro adds an aromatic touch that’s hard to resist. Mixing these ingredients creates a colorful medley that will make your salad pop!

Step 3: Make the Dressing

In a small bowl, whisk together soy sauce, lime juice, honey, sesame oil, ginger, garlic, salt, and pepper. This dressing packs a flavorful punch and ties all the ingredients together beautifully. Taste testing here is key—feel free to adjust according to your preference!

Step 4: Combine Everything

In a large bowl, combine your cooled quinoa with all those beautiful veggies. Pour the dressing over this mixture and toss gently until everything is well coated. This step ensures every ingredient gets its fair share of that scrumptious flavor!

Step 5: Chill Out

For best results, chill your salad in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es before serving. Allowing time for flavors to meld enhances the overall taste experience—trust me; it’s worth the wait!

Pro Tips for Making Thai Quinoa Crunch Salad: A Refreshing Healthy Delight!

Creating the perfect Thai Quinoa Crunch Salad is all about balance and freshness, so here are some pro tips to help you shine in the kitchen!

  • Rinse Your Quinoa: Always rinse your quinoa before cooking. This removes the natural coating called saponin, which can give it a bitter taste. Rinsing ensures that your salad tastes fresh and delightful.

  • Chill for Flavor: Letting your salad ch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es allows the flavors to meld beautifully. This step enhances the taste, making each bite a refreshing burst of flavor.

  • Customize Your Veggies: Feel free to swap out or add any crunchy vegetables you love! Options like bell peppers, radishes, or even snap peas can add different textures and flavors, keeping your salad exciting every time you make it.

  • Adjust the Dressing: Taste as you go! You can modify the dressing according to your preference by adding more lime juice for tanginess or honey for sweetness. This will make sure it suits your palate perfectly.

  • Use Fresh Herbs: Fresh herbs like cilantro really elevate this salad. If you’re not a fan of cilantro, try using fresh mint or basil instead; they both bring a unique flavor profile that complements the other ingredients beautifully.

Make Ahead and Storage

This Thai Quinoa Crunch Salad is not only delicious but also perfect for meal prep! You can easily make it ahead of time and enjoy it throughout the week. Here’s how to store it properly to keep it fresh and tasty.

Storing Leftovers

  • Store any leftovers in an airtight container.
  • Keep the salad in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
  • If possible, store the dressing separately until you’re ready to eat for maximum freshness.

Freezing

  • This salad is best enjoyed fresh, but if you want to freeze it:
  • Place the quinoa and vegetables in a freezer-safe container without dressing.
  • It can be frozen for up to one month. Thaw overnight in the fridge before serving.

Reheating

  • For best results, serve this salad cold or at room temperature.
  • If you prefer to warm it slightly, use a microwave on low power for short intervals, stirring in between until warmed through.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up quinoa
  • 2 cups water
  • 1 cup red bell pepper, diced
  • 1 cup cucumber, diced
  • 1 cup shredded carrots
  • 1 cup green onions, sliced
  • 1/2 cup chopped fresh cilantro
  • 1/2 cup chopped peanuts
  • 1/4 cup sesame seeds
  • 1/4 cup soy sauce
  • 2 tablespoons lime juice
  • 1 tablespoon honey
  • 1 tablespoon sesame oil
  • 1 teaspoon grated fresh ginger
  • 1 clove garlic, minced

Instructions

  1. Rinse quinoa under cold water. In a saucepan, combine quinoa and water; bring to a boil. Lower heat and simmer for about 15 minutes until fluffy.
  2. While quinoa cools, chop all vegetables: red bell pepper, cucumber, carrots, green onions, and cilantro.
  3. In a small bowl, whisk together soy sauce, lime juice, honey, sesame oil, ginger, garlic, salt, and pepper for the dressing.
  4. In a large bowl, combine cooled quinoa with chopped vegetables. Pour dressing over and toss gently to mix.
  5. Ch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es before serving to enhance flavors.
